SpringCloud与Docker微服务架构实战读书笔记(一)

微服务架构概述 单体应用架构存在的问题 单体应用:一个归档包(例如war格式)包含所有功能的应用程序 优点:比较容易部署、测试 缺点: 复杂性高:一个应用百万行级别,修改代码容易牵一发而动全身 技术债务:已使用的系统设计或代码难以被修改 部署频率低:构建和部署的时间长→部署频率低→两次发布之间有大量功能变更与缺陷修复,出错概率比较高 可靠性差:某个应用bug,可能会导致整个应用的崩溃 扩展能力受限
相关文章
相关标签/搜索